What is Enteral Feeding?
Enteral feeding describes any type of method of supplying nutrition straight into the intestinal system, primarily through tubes such as nasogastric (NG) tubes or perc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y (PEG) tubes. Overview of PEG Feeding
What is PEG Feeding?
Percutaneous Endoscopic Gastrostomy (PEG) feeding includes putting a tube into the belly through an endoscopically led procedure. This method enables long-term nutritional support when dental intake is inadequate or unsafe.
Indications for PEG Feeding
Neurological Conditions: Problems like stroke or ALS where ingesting is compromised. Cancer: Clients undergoing treatment may experience troubles with eating. Chronic Illnesses: Such as persistent ob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) or mental deterioration where hunger diminishes.Benefits of PEG Feeding
- Provides straight access to the stomach Long-term remedy for nutrition Easier management compared to other methods
Risks and Complications Connected with PEG Feeding
While PEG feeding deals various advantages, it also carries risks such as infection at the insertion site, tube variation, and possible complications associated with desire pneumonia.
Key Components of Enteral Nutrition Support
Nutritional Formulas Made use of in Enteral Feeding
Standard Solutions: Appropriate for people without malabsorption issues. Elemental Formulas: Predigested nutrients optimal for patients with absorption difficulties. Disease-Specific Formulas: Tailored for specific conditions such as diabetes or kidney failure.Calculating Nutritional Needs
Understanding just how to calculate an individual's caloric requirements is vital in supplying adequate nutrition with enteral feeds. The Harris-Benedict equation is generally made use of:
[BMR = 66 + (6.23 \ times weight \ text in lbs) + (12.7 \ times elevation \ text in inches) - (6.8 \ times age \ message in years)]
Monitoring Patient Tolerance to Enteral Feeds
Regularly examining exactly how well a patient endures their feeds includes surveillance:
- Abdominal distension Nausea and vomiting Diarrhea or constipation Signs of ambition

FAQs About Enteral Feeding
What is PEG feeding?
PEG feeding describes offering nutrients straight right into a client's tummy via a tube placed with the abdominal wall.
How typically must I check my PEG tube?
Regular checks need to take place daily, concentrating on cleanliness at the insertion website and correct performance of the tubes system.
Can I provide medications through a PEG tube?
Yes, but drugs need to be liquid kinds unless otherwise defined by healthcare providers; consult your pharmacologist prior to administration.
Is there any kind of certain diet I need while receiving enterally fed?
Dietary suggestions are customized according to individual wellness problems; consult your dietitian for personalized advice.
What occurs if my tube ends up being dislodged?
If dislodgement happens, look for immediate medical support; do not try reinsertion unless educated properly.
How can relative help during my recuperation with PEG feeds?
Member of the family can discover fundamental care treatments like cleansing around stoma sites while using emotional assistance throughout recovery processes.
